THE Rappahannock Supervisors’ office space study committee was reconstituted at the March meeting of the board. Its task remains evaluating current county space needs, and recommending the best way of solving those needs.

A new committee was named after Chairman Pete Luke noted that action taken at the February meeting on a '“study committee conflicted with a previous action. Luke was absent from the February meeting because of illness.

Supervisor H. B. Wood agreed that the conflict ought to be resolved, but he thought that in setting up a committee, at least one person ought to be named from every magisterial district. “Hie more input we get from citizens, the better oft we’ll be,” he said; maybe, even, two members from each district would be better.
